Management Commentary

During the public Q1 2026 earnings call, James leadership focused discussion on operational efficiency efforts rolled out across the firm’s global manufacturing and distribution network in recent months. Management noted that targeted supply chain optimizations, dynamic production scaling to match regional demand shifts, and targeted cost-control measures may have supported profitability during the quarter, contributing to the reported EPS figure. Leadership also addressed questions about end-market demand trends, noting that residential repair and remodel activity has remained relatively resilient in many of JHX’s highest-margin markets, while new residential construction demand has been more variable across regions. Representatives from the firm confirmed that full consolidated revenue data is still undergoing final audit procedures, and will be released in a supplementary filing as soon as the process is complete, so no formal revenue commentary was provided during the call. Forward Guidance

James did not issue formal quantitative forward guidance alongside its Q1 2026 earnings release, but leadership did outline key strategic priorities for upcoming operating periods. The firm noted that it is evaluating potential investments in sustainable product innovation and expanded production capacity in select high-growth regional markets, moves that could support long-term market share gains if demand trends align with internal projections. Management also noted that ongoing volatility in global raw material pricing and interest rate environments across core operating regions may create near-term operational uncertainty, so the firm is maintaining flexible budgeting and production planning frameworks to adapt to changing market conditions as needed. No specific timelines for capital expenditure decisions were shared during the call.
